== Function 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/PARC_STRPN PARC_STRPN] Topoisomerase IV is essential for chromosome segregation. It relaxes supercoiled DNA. Performs the decatenation events required during the replication of a circular DNA molecule.<ref>PMID:17375187</ref> <ref>PMID:20596531</ref> [https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/PARE_STRPN PARE_STRPN] Topoisomerase IV is essential for chromosome segregation. It relaxes supercoiled DNA. Performs the decatenation events required during the replication of a circular DNA molecule.<ref>PMID:17375187</ref> <ref>PMID:20596531</ref>
